Sammie Benjamin Anderson III, 74, died May 22, 2017 at home after an illness. Born in Darlington, SC, January 16, 1943, he was the son of Sammie and Marguerite Anderson. He was a graduate of St. John's High School, Class of 1961. He served in the SC Army National Guard for 8 years. After 45 ½ years at Sonoco Products Co. in Hartsville as a machinist, he retired in Jan. 2008. Bennie also, after retirement, worked with Belk Funeral Home. The almost 9 years he worked with Sidney and Curry Belk were the most fulfilling and blessed years during his work life.
